Episode 3: When Christmas Was Christmas

What's Hot Today

Episode 3

Editor's Pick

This Week in TV »

Unknownfear's pick for week of Dec 17, 2017

Happy is insane. If you were a fan of Syfy’s violent extravaganza Blood Drive, then you simply must check this show out Rating:

Rating Stats

19 ratings

AVG: 3.76